About This Show

Mrs. Helen Alving’s struggle with the ghosts of her past is about to come to an end. Tomorrow, commemorating the tenth anniversary of her husband’s death, a new orphanage will be dedicated in his name.

For twenty-nine years, since her mother and two aunts arranged for her to marry the wealthy, charming Captain Alving, Helen has kept a dark secret – the reality of her late husband’s deviant excesses and his disease. Now, with her son Osvald finally home to stay after many years abroad, a triumphant new life begins. The past will be buried forever.

But her spiritual liberation is about to meet a catastrophic fate in one of the great plays of the world stage by one of its greatest dramatists, Henrik Ibsen. This English language adaptation of “Ghosts” will prove as haunting for modern audiences as its title.
